Ripple expands institutional custody stack with staking and security integrations

Ripple has enhanced its institutional custody platform with new integrations, allowing banks and custodians to offer custody and staking services without their own infrastructure. This move builds on Ripple's recent acquisitions and aims to simplify deployment for institutional clients, reflecting growing interest in staking and secure digital asset management.

Ripple has announced significant enhancements to its institutional custody platform, allowing banks and custodians to offer custody and staking services without the need for their own validator or key-management infrastructure. These new integrations, made with Securosys and Figment, incorporate hardware security modules aimed at simplifying the deployment of these services. By reducing complexity, Ripple hopes to facilitate faster rollouts of custody services tailored for institutional clients.

This latest development builds on Ripple's recent acquisition of Palisade and the addition of Chainalysis compliance tools. The upgraded custody solutions enable regulated institutions to manage cryptographic keys using either on-premises or cloud-based hardware security modules (HSMs). Furthermore, the platform supports staking on popular proof-of-stake networks like Ethereum and Solana, embedding compliance checks directly into transaction workflows.

Ripple's push into institutional infrastructure marks a strategic shift as the company seeks to expand its offerings beyond traditional payments. By venturing into custody, treasury, and post-trade services, Ripple aims to cater to regulated companies looking for comprehensive solutions. Notably, Ripple is not just a payments facilitator; it is also the issuer of the XRP token and the recently launched dollar-pegged stablecoin, RLUSD.

The recent upgrades come in the wake of growing institutional interest in staking, particularly as proof-of-stake networks gain traction. Institutions have been keen to tap into the yield-generating potential offered by staking, especially as regulatory environments continue to evolve. Ripple's new offerings appear to align well with these trends, providing a more streamlined approach for institutions that wish to engage in staking activities.

In October, Figment expanded its partnership with Coinbase, allowing Coinbase Custody and Prime clients to stake additional proof-of-stake assets beyond Ethereum. This integration brings access to staking on various networks, including Solana, Sui, Aptos, and Avalanche, further highlighting the rising demand for institutional staking solutions. Similarly, Anchorage Digital recently added staking support for the Hyperliquid ecosystem, allowing institutions to stake HYPE alongside their existing custody services.

While staking presents a lucrative avenue for institutions, parallel initiatives are emerging to generate yield from Bitcoin, which, unlike proof-of-stake networks, does not support staking. Earlier this month, Fireblocks announced its integration with Stacks, enabling institutional clients to access Bitcoin-based lending and yield products. This innovative integration leverages Stacks' rapid block times to settle transactions on the Bitcoin ledger, addressing latency issues that have historically limited institutional adoption of Bitcoin-based decentralized finance.

Ripple's advancements reflect a broader trend in the industry as financial institutions increasingly seek to incorporate digital assets into their existing frameworks. The demand for secure and efficient custody solutions is more pressing than ever, particularly as institutional interest continues to grow. Ripple's move to enhance its custody stack is a clear indication that the company is committed to meeting these evolving needs.

Overall, Ripple's latest initiatives come at a pivotal moment for the cryptocurrency market. As institutions navigate the complexities of digital asset management, the tools and infrastructure provided by companies like Ripple will be crucial in shaping the future of finance. With a focus on compliance, security, and ease of deployment, Ripple is positioning itself as a leader in the institutional cryptocurrency space. As the market continues to mature, the importance of robust custody solutions will only increase, making Ripple's recent enhancements timely and significant.
